Qwikker and Prime Point Media Launch Payphone-Based Content Distribution Network in U.S.

The companies plan a rollout of 2500 locations by the end of 2007

Qwikker and Prime Point Media announced that the two companies are working together to enable the delivery of multimedia content to mobile phones and wireless devices via Bluetooth technology from payphone kiosks across the U.S. The first content campaign on the network went live in November 2006, distributing a promotional video on behalf of the U.S. Navy Reserve. The companies are planning a progressive rollout of 2500 locations by the end of 2007.

"We are excited to be driving forward the transformation of the out of home media industry with the rollout of this exciting
new interactive platform," said Karen Robinson, CEO of Prime Point Media. "With the addition of local wireless content delivery to our network of payphones, we can offer our customers a contextually relevant way of delivering rich mobile content at no cost to the end user."

In addition to the delivery of single media files and content items, Qwikker allows brands to deliver mobile channels, which are collections of user-selectable content, interactive information, video clips, mp3s, pictures, ring tones, games, and clickable links, stored on the mobile device and available at a later time for users to share content or respond to a brand. Qwikker runs the largest direct-to-mobile location content network in the world, with over 700 Bluetooth content distribution points across the US and UK. Brands which have leveraged the Qwikker network include Yahoo!, Channel 4, Electronic Arts, Universal Music, 20th Century Fox, Red Bull, Virgin Mobile, Robbie Williams/ie: music, Nokia and Universal Pictures.

"Our content distribution network is helping companies solve the practical problem of direct-to-consumer mobile content distribution," said Saul Kato, founder and CTO of Qwikker. "We are excited about working with Prime Point Media to help them deliver a flexible and rich solution to meet their media customer's needs."

Prime Point Media, a division of OutdoorPartner Media, is a provider of national payphone advertising. Many of the world's best known brands, including American Express, Anheuser-Busch, Bank of America, Bristol-Myers Squibb, Coca-Cola, General Motors, Ford, Miller Brewing, Proctor and Gamble, Time Warner and Verizon, have run advertising programs with the company.
